Annotated Snippet
//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0
/*
* linux/arch/sh/boards/se/7721/irq.c
*
* Copyright (C) 2008 Renesas Solutions Corp.
*/
#include <linux/init.h>
#include <linux/irq.h>
#include <linux/interrupt.h>
#include <linux/io.h>
#include <mach-se/mach/se7721.h>
enum {
UNUSED = 0,
/* board specific interrupt sources */
MRSHPC,
};
static struct intc_vect vectors[] __initdata = {
INTC_IRQ(MRSHPC, MRSHPC_IRQ0),
};
static struct intc_prio_reg prio_registers[] __initdata = {
{ FPGA_ILSR6, 0, 8, 4, /* IRLMSK */
{ 0, MRSHPC } },
};
static DECLARE_INTC_DESC(intc_desc, "SE7721", vectors,
NULL, NULL, prio_registers, NULL);
/*
* Initialize IRQ setting
*/
void __init init_se7721_IRQ(void)
{
/* PPCR */
__raw_writew(__raw_readw(0xa4050118) & ~0x00ff, 0xa4050118);
register_intc_controller(&intc_desc);
intc_set_priority(MRSHPC_IRQ0, 0xf - MRSHPC_IRQ0);
}
